版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
编程创意教师培训课件汇报人:XX目录01课程概述03编程基础教学02教学理念介绍04课程内容设计05教学资源与工具06教师专业发展课程概述PARTONE编程教育意义通过编程学习,学生能够锻炼逻辑思维,提高解决问题的能力,如使用算法解决数学问题。培养逻辑思维能力掌握编程技能可为学生未来在科技领域的就业市场中增加优势,如数据分析、软件开发等岗位。增强未来就业竞争力编程教育鼓励学生创造新事物,例如开发个人项目或游戏,培养创新精神和创造力。激发创新与创造力010203培训目标定位01培训旨在使教师能够熟练掌握至少一种编程语言的基础知识和应用。掌握编程基础02课程设计将注重激发学生对编程的兴趣,培养其解决问题的能力。激发学生兴趣03教师将学习如何运用创新的教学方法,使编程教学更加生动有趣。教学方法创新04教师将学习如何设计符合学生认知水平的编程课程内容,确保教学效果。课程内容设计课程结构安排课程将理论知识与实际编程案例相结合,确保教师能够学以致用。理论与实践相结合课程内容被划分为多个模块,每个模块专注于特定的编程概念或技能。模块化教学内容通过小组讨论和项目合作,教师在互动中学习和掌握编程教学方法。互动式学习环节课程中包含定期的评估和反馈环节,帮助教师及时了解学习进度和改进方向。持续性评估与反馈教学理念介绍PARTTWO创新教学方法通过实际编程项目,让学生在解决问题的过程中学习编程,增强实践能力和创新思维。项目式学习利用编程游戏和挑战赛,激发学生学习兴趣,使编程学习变得更加生动有趣。游戏化教学鼓励学生进行小组合作编程,通过团队协作提高沟通能力和代码质量。协作编程学生中心理念教师应根据学生的兴趣和需求设计课程内容,激发学生的学习动力和创造力。以学生需求为导向鼓励学生通过项目、探究式学习等方式,培养自主学习能力和解决问题的能力。促进学生主动学习认识到每个学生的独特性,提供个性化的指导和支持,帮助每个学生达到最佳学习效果。重视学生个体差异教学互动策略项目式学习提问与引导0103设计实际项目,让学生在完成项目的过程中学习编程知识,提高实践能力。通过提问激发学生思考,引导他们主动探索问题的答案,增强学习的主动性。02分组让学生共同解决问题,通过团队合作培养沟通能力和协作精神。小组合作学习编程基础教学PARTTHREE编程语言选择选择适合不同年龄段学生的编程语言,如Scratch适合儿童,Python适合青少年。针对年龄阶段选择语言考虑学校现有的教学资源和师资力量,选择与之相匹配的编程语言进行教学。结合学校资源选择易于学习和使用的语言,如Python以其简洁的语法和强大的库支持受到初学者青睐。评估语言的易用性根据教学目标选择语言,例如,若目标是教授算法思维,可选择Python或Java。考虑课程目标选择在工业界广泛使用的编程语言,如Java或C++,为学生未来的职业发展打下基础。考虑语言的实用性基础知识讲解选择合适的编程语言是教学的第一步,如Python因其简洁性常作为初学者入门语言。编程语言的选择介绍变量、数据类型、控制结构等编程基础概念,为学生打下坚实的编程基础。基本编程概念通过教授基本算法和逻辑思维训练,帮助学生理解程序的运行逻辑和解决问题的方法。算法与逻辑思维实践案例分析通过Scratch编程平台,学生可以创建自己的故事和游戏,提高编程兴趣和逻辑思维能力。互动式学习平台组织学生参与在线编程竞赛,如Codeforces或LeetCode,锻炼算法思维和编程速度。代码编写竞赛学生通过编程乐高Mindstorms机器人完成一系列任务,如迷宫导航,培养解决问题的能力。机器人编程挑战课程内容设计PARTFOUR课程模块划分介绍编程语言的基本元素,如变量、数据类型、控制结构等,为学员打下坚实的理论基础。基础编程概念01通过实际项目案例,让学员在实践中学习编程,分析问题解决过程,提升动手能力。项目实践与案例分析02分享有效的教学策略和互动技巧,帮助教师更好地传授编程知识,激发学生兴趣。教学方法与技巧03教学活动设计设计小组合作的编程项目,鼓励学生通过解决实际问题来学习编程,如制作小游戏。互动式编程挑战安排学生进行代码审查,通过讨论彼此的代码来提高编程技能和理解代码质量的重要性。代码审查与讨论引入编程思维游戏,如逻辑谜题和算法设计,以培养学生的逻辑思维和问题解决能力。编程思维游戏组织学生进行项目展示,通过同伴和教师的反馈来提升学生的表达能力和项目完善度。项目展示与反馈评估与反馈机制通过日常作业、小测验等方式,实时跟踪学生学习进度,及时调整教学策略。形成性评估01020304学生之间相互评价作品,提供反馈,培养批判性思维和沟通能力。同伴评审鼓励学生自我反思学习过程和成果,增强自主学习意识和自我改进能力。自我评估教师根据学生表现提供个性化反馈,帮助学生明确改进方向,提升学习效果。教师反馈教学资源与工具PARTFIVE教学软件推荐LeetCode和HackerRank为教师提供丰富的编程题目,适合进行编程技能的提升和竞赛准备。使用Tynker或Alice等VR编程工具,学生可以在虚拟世界中创造和编程,增强学习体验。Scratch和C提供互动式编程学习环境,适合初学者,通过游戏化教学激发学习兴趣。互动编程平台虚拟现实编程工具在线编程挑战平台硬件设备介绍01智能投影仪智能投影仪能够将教学内容放大展示,增强学生视觉体验,适用于演示代码和图形。02可编程机器人套件机器人套件如LEGOMindstorms或Arduino套件,让学生通过编程控制实体机器人,激发学习兴趣。033D打印机3D打印机能够将学生设计的模型打印出来,让学生直观理解编程与物理世界的关系。在线资源利用开源编程平台01利用GitHub等开源平台,教师可以引导学生参与真实项目,提升编程实践能力。在线编程挑战02通过Codeforces、LeetCode等在线竞赛平台,学生可以参与编程挑战,锻炼解决问题的能力。互动式学习工具03使用Repl.it或Trinket等工具,学生可以直接在浏览器中编写、运行代码,实现即时反馈。教师专业发展PARTSIX持续学习路径03定期阅读教育学、计算机科学领域的专业书籍和期刊,以获取深入的理论知识和实践案例。阅读专业书籍和期刊02定期参与教育技术研讨会,与同行交流经验,了解最新的教育科技趋势。参与教育研讨会01教师可以通过参加MOOCs(大型开放在线课程)来学习新的编程语言或教学方法。参加在线课程04通过开展编程相关的实践项目或教学实验,将理论知识应用于实际教学中,提升教学效果。实践项目和教学实验教学技能提升教师通过学习项目式学习、翻转课堂等现代教学法,提高编程课程的互动性和实践性。掌握编程教学法教师定期参与同行评审,通过互相观摩和反馈,提升教学设计和课堂管理能力。开展同行评审教师学习使用各种教育技术工具,如编程模拟器、在线协作平台,以丰富教学手段。利用教育技术工具教师参加编程教育相关的研讨会和工作坊,与专家交流,不断更新教育理念和方法。参与专业研讨会01020304教师交流平台教师可以利用Google
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 感恩活动策划方案流程(3篇)
- 江门地产活动策划方案(3篇)
- 活动策划方案赚钱文案(3篇)
- 跨年欢聚活动策划方案(3篇)
- 2026年及未来5年市场数据中国投资保险行业市场深度分析及发展趋势预测报告
- 人力资源部门内部管理制度
- 2026湖南株洲市应急管理局辅助人员招聘5人备考题库附答案
- 2026珠海港股份有限公司校园招聘考试备考题库附答案
- 2026福建省选调生选拔400人参考题库附答案
- 2026贵州贵阳市白云区艳山红镇中心卫生院村医招聘参考题库附答案
- 2025年新疆中考数学真题试卷及答案
- 2025届新疆乌鲁木齐市高三下学期三模英语试题(解析版)
- DB3210T1036-2019 补充耕地快速培肥技术规程
- 混动能量管理与电池热管理的协同优化-洞察阐释
- T-CPI 11029-2024 核桃壳滤料标准规范
- 统编版语文三年级下册整本书阅读《中国古代寓言》推进课公开课一等奖创新教学设计
- 《顾客感知价值对绿色酒店消费意愿的影响实证研究-以三亚S酒店为例(附问卷)15000字(论文)》
- 劳动仲裁申请书电子版模板
- 赵然尊:胸痛中心时钟统一、时间节点定义与时间管理
- 家用燃气灶结构、工作原理、配件介绍、常见故障处理
- ZD(J)9-型电动转辙机
评论
0/150
提交评论